Lots of potential here. Lighting system in wow is very limited, so you have to basically paint in your own lighting. shadow colors seem too monochromatic. I suggest painting the character with warm colors in lights, and cooler colors in the shadows. Temperature control is paramount. Bigger thicker details too. So instead…
